"This evening we had a takeaway: Whitebait, calamary, reg chips, reg haddock, tartare sauce, thai fish cake. £39 of order. We were very happy to be back and using Chipwick, as we leave not too far. Haddock, whitebait and tartare sauce fresh. I’m sure even the other two items were fresh as well. Too fresh that the fishcake was raw inside: homemade for sure but just a fish+mash potatoes patty big like an adult hand and uncooked. The calamari were way too much oily that to try to eat it we started to take out the coating. I’m sure the young chef was feeling the pressure of a 7pm rush (5 orders before us but this is not a justification for cooking a raw dish and one that is too oily. Maybe the oil wasn't ready or some new oil had been added to the fryer? You don't expect this service from an award-winning restaurant. When called, the staff was kind when they offered us to prepare another portion of fishcake, which we refused only to avoid going out in the rain to get it. Another complaint is that the female staff at the till should have their hair tied up, not touch it in front of customers and then prepare food without washing their hands. It is not a good practice in a food area!!! Chipwick as a restaurant has not lost us as customers (the fish is always fresh not frozen! but we hope, next time, to find all the food at the best standards that have characterized this place all these years."
